摘要
A green synthesis protocol for the synthesis of colloidal gold nanoparticles is proposed. The synthesis involves the use of garlic (Allium sativum) extract as reducing agent. The reduction is carried out by slow addition of the Allium sativum extract to the chloroauric acid at boiling and gives spherically shaped nanoparticles, with 10-20 nm size distribution and mean diameters of 15 nm. The gold nanoparticles are characterized by UV-VIS spectroscopy, Fourier Transform Infrared Spectroscopy, Transmission Electron Microscopy, and Surface-Enhanced Raman Scattering. In vitro tests are also performed on human fetal lung fibroblast HFL-1 cells and the nanoparticles are found to be non cytotoxic for the cells in the concentration range used in our study. Confocal microscopy shows that the particles are localised in the cell cytoplasm.
